For arch X64, system will enable the page table in SPI to cover 0-512G range via CR4.PAE & MSR.LME & CR0.PG & CR3 setting. Existing code doesn't cover the higher address access above 512G before memory-discovered callback. This series patches provide the solution to enable paging from temporary RAM Done.
Jiaxin Wu (3): UefiCpuPkg/SecCore: Migrate page table to permanent memory UefiCpuPkg/CpuMpPei: Enable PAE page table if CR0.PG is not set MdeModulePkg/DxeIpl: Align Page table Level setting with previous level.
